2 stars Gosh ! This is really bad.

For some reason, Black Sabbath wanted to be just an ordinary heavy metal band after Ozzy left the band. The result was a lot of boring AOR like heavy metal albums. The innovations from their first six albums was gone. After Dio, Gillan and Gillen left the band, it was Tony Martin's turn to sing. And the result is not good at all. The only good song here is Black Sabbath. All the other songs has been re-arranged to fit Tony Martin's voice...... with a predictable bad result.

This is indeed a dire live album. At least it juste proves how good Ronnie James Dio and Ozzy Osbourne was as vocalists. Black Sabbath just sounds uninspired money-grabbing on this album and throughout this period of their career. Two stars for the good songs alone is all I can give.
